The normal complement of deciduous teeth or milk teeth is twenty, ten in each jaw.

They start appearing by the age of six months and should be complete by about two and half years. They then start falling off from the age of 6 years and continue falling till about 13 years .

How many cuspid teeth in the mouth?

There are a total of four cuspid teeth in the mouth, with one located in each quadrant. These teeth are also commonly referred to as canines due to their pointed, cusp-like shape. Cuspid teeth are important for cutting and tearing food.
